What does "tabloid" mean?

  1. noun A newspaper printed at roughly half the size of a broadsheet, typically known for punchy, sensational stories rather than sober reporting.
    "The tabloid ran the celebrity breakup as its front-page story."
  2. adj Written or presented in a sensational, attention-grabbing style typical of tabloid newspapers.
    "The documentary was criticized for its tabloid approach to a serious topic."
